Case Summary: CR/158/2025 The High Court of Chhattisgarh disposed of SBI General Insurance Company's revision petition challenging the Motor Accidents Claims Tribunal's rejection of its limitation defense. The insurance company sought dismissal of a motor accident compensation claim filed over 6 months after the November 2022 accident, arguing it was barred by limitation under Section 166(3) of the Motor Vehicles Act, 1988. Following the Supreme Court's directive in ICICI Lombard v. Ayiti Navaneetha (November 2025) that tribunals should not dismiss claims on limitation grounds while the issue remains pending before the Apex Court, the High Court allowed the tribunal to proceed with the case but prohibited passing a final order until the Supreme Court adjudicates the limitation issue in the pending cases.
